#d76053 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d76053 is composed of 84.3% red, 37.6%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 5.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 58.4%. #d76053 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0a6 with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d76053 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d76053 has RGB values of R:215, G:96,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.61,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14114899.

Shades and Tints of #d76053
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d76053
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969494 is the less saturated color, while #f84632 is the most saturated one.
